Orphan's Pension: Support for Children in Rotterdam After a Parent's Death

Orphan's pension provides financial support to children in Rotterdam who have lost a parent. It offers a monthly benefit until the child turns 18 or completes their studies. Orphans receive this allowance through the General Survivors Act (Anw) and employer pension schemes. What Does Orphan's Pension Mean for Rotterdam Families?

Orphan's pension, or orphan's benefit, is a survivor's benefit for children under 18 or students up to age 27. It compensates for income loss due to a parent's death. Key types:

  • Anw orphan's benefit: Applied for at the Social Insurance Bank (SVB), based on the deceased's AOW state pension.
  • Orphan's pension from pension fund: Additional benefits via the employer's pension scheme, such as those at Rotterdam port companies.
These can be combined. In 2024, for example, the Anw benefit is €390.17 net per month for a single child (amounts are adjusted annually).

Legal Rules for Orphan's Pension

Benefits are governed by national laws:

  1. General Survivors Act (Anw): Chapter 3, Articles 24-30, for basic benefits to children of AOW-insured individuals.
  2. Pension Act (Pw): Article 72 requires funds to provide orphan's pensions, often 40-70% of the parent's pension.
  3. WIA and Sickness Benefits Act: Temporary benefits if the parent was ill or work-disabled.
Funds like ABP, PFZW, or bpfBOUW (relevant for Rotterdam construction and port workers) handle this. Check the deceased's pension overview or seek advice from the Juridisch Loket Rotterdam.

Conditions for Receiving Orphan's Pension in Rotterdam

For Rotterdam children, these requirements apply:

  • Age under 18, or 18-27 if in education (no full-time job).
  • Deceased was Anw-insured (AOW) or had a pension.
  • Residence in the Netherlands or EU (with conditions).
  • Family income below the Anw threshold of €25,000 gross per year (2024).
Stepchildren and foster children have equal rights.

How Much Orphan's Pension and for How Long in Practice?

Amounts vary:

  • Anw: €390.17 for first child, €195.09 for subsequent children (net, 2024).
  • Pension fund: Typically 30% of parent's pension per child, e.g., €200-€500 gross.
It runs until age 18, or 27 if studying (vocational, higher professional, or university). Ends upon completion of studies. Adjusted annually for wages/prices.

Examples of Orphan's Pension for Rotterdam Children

Example 1: Lisa (12) from Rotterdam-Zuid loses her father, a port worker with bpfBOUW pension. Anw (€390) + fund benefit (€280) = €670 net until age 18.

Example 2: Tim (20), an HBO student in Rotterdam, mother deceased. With €10,000 in side earnings, Anw continues (below threshold), plus €320 fund benefit until graduation.

Example 3: Both parents deceased: No doubling, but possible SVB supplement.

Rights and Obligations with Orphan's Pension

Rights:

  • Automatic notification by SVB after death.
  • Back payments for late claims (up to 1 year).
  • Objection/appeal via Rotterdam District Court (Rechtspraak.nl).
Obligations:
  • Report death within 8 days to Rotterdam Municipality for death certificate.
  • Report changes: studies, income, address.
  • Prove income.
Failure to report? Repayment may be required. Help available at Juridisch Loket Rotterdam.

Frequently Asked Questions About Orphan's Pension in Rotterdam

Do I Get Orphan's Pension Without Parental Pension?

No for pension funds, but yes for Anw if AOW-insured. Check UWV or Juridisch Loket Rotterdam for extras.

Until What Age for Orphan's Pension?

Until 18 automatically, 18-27 if studying (MBO/HBO/university), no full-time work. Proof required.

Can I Work Alongside Orphan's Pension?

Yes, but Anw income below €25,000 gross (2024). Funds are more lenient.

Divorce or Stepparent?

Stepchildren qualify if living together. Anw often stops after remarriage unless adoption. Ask Juridisch Loket Rotterdam.
